		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Good site. I at all times train hard at least 3 times a week and following a grueling session your body needs the finest quality protein to mend you for your subsequently workout. I at all times go for lean protein as the most excellent muscle building food, principally poultry, turkey in addition to fish. I also consume scrambled egg whites for breakfast.I in general combine these meals with a complex carb and vegetables as well. I stay away from protein shakes as I see them as a waste of money, the body is designed to digest foods and drinks lack the thermic affect of foods.</p>
